The Video Surveillance Market was valued at USD 52.73 billion in 2023 and is projected to grow to USD 57.01 billion in 2024, with a CAGR of 8.53%, reaching USD 93.54 billion by 2030.
KEY MARKET STATISTICS | |
---|---|
Base Year [2023] | USD 52.73 billion |
Estimated Year [2024] | USD 57.01 billion |
Forecast Year [2030] | USD 93.54 billion |
CAGR (%) | 8.53% |

Key Segmentation Insights Driving Market Innovations
The segmentation of the video surveillance market provides deep insights into the diversified nature of the industry. A detailed analysis based on the system highlights three primary categories: Analog Video Surveillance System, Hybrid Video Surveillance System, and IP Video Surveillance System. These platforms not only delineate the technological transition from traditional analog formats to advanced IP systems but also expose opportunities for superior integration of analytics and network-based functionalities.
Further segmentation based on offering reveals the distinct categories of Hardware, Services, and Software, each playing a critical role in market evolution. The Hardware segment encompasses Accessories, Camera systems, and Storage Devices. Within the Camera category, the division extends into Wired Cameras and Wireless Cameras, reflecting the need for diverse deployment strategies across various locations. Additionally, Storage Devices are evaluated across Digital Video Recorders, Direct-Attached Storage Devices, Hybrid Video Recorders, Network Video Recorders, and Network-Attached Storage Devices. The Services segment, which includes Installation & Maintenance Services and Video Surveillance-As-A-Service (VSaaS), underscores the necessity for reliable post-installation support and the rising demand for cloud-based, service-driven models. Parallelly, Software offerings emphasize the significance of Video Analytics and Video Management Software in transforming raw footage into actionable intelligence.
Furthermore, market segmentation based on vertical applications segments the landscape into Commercial, Industrial, Infrastructure, Military & Defense, and Residential. The Commercial sector is further broken down into Banking & Finance Buildings, Enterprises & Data Centers, Hospitality Centers, Retail Stores & Malls, and Warehouses; while the Infrastructure category is assessed across City Surveillance, Public Places, Transportation, and Utilities. The Military & Defense segment incorporates Border Surveillance, Coastal Surveillance, Law Enforcement, as well as Prison & Correctional Facilities. Key Regional Insights Shaping the Global Market
Examining the global spread of video surveillance solutions, an in-depth look at key regions sheds light on distinct market dynamics and growth drivers. The Americas have emerged as a leading market, driven by extensive modernization efforts, technological investments, and the presence of numerous geopolitical factors that bolster advanced surveillance implementations. In this region, there is a pronounced focus on leveraging cutting-edge security systems to support both government and private sector applications.
Across Europe, the Middle East, and Africa, the divergence in economic development and regulatory frameworks creates an environment where the demand for tailored surveillance solutions is very high. This region benefits from both urban development projects and expansive public infrastructure programs, which encourage the integration of sophisticated systems that enhance situational awareness and public security. Attention is particularly paid to ensuring that technological integrations comply with stringent regulatory standards, providing robust solutions that are both scalable and secure.
In the Asia-Pacific region, unprecedented growth is driven by rapid urbanization, technological adoption, and investment in smart city initiatives. The region's markets are experiencing a surge in demand for IP-based systems and integrated surveillance solutions that match the pace of economic development.
